A non-parody editorial
MMO fans are one of the largest collections of fools on the Internet.
A developer gives us a website, a few pages of lore, perhaps a piece of concept art or two, and a message board. Within days they can expect a rabid following of anywhere from 500 to 5,000 people, all debating the pros and cons of their game and asking when they're going to get in beta, without ever writing a single line of code.
I call this phenomenon the Community in a Box.
Imagine a “musician” starting a website. He's never released an album before--he may in fact have never played a single note. All he has is his website, a few words about what he'd like to record for his first album, and a concept sketch of the cover. Nothing specific, but he promises more information soon, or when he finishes a few tracks. He puts up a message board, and encourages people to give their thoughts on the subject.
Now picture this conversation, taking place on said message board:
Fanboy #1: God I hate bass. I just know he's going to use too much bass, and there's no way in hell I'm buying this album if there's bass in it.
Fanboy #2: Are you an idiot? Bass is the best part of the entire album! I refuse to buy an album that doesn't have bass and that's final.
Fanboy #3: Well I think you can strike a balance between bass and treble, there are gray areas you know...
Fanboy #2: Gray area?! Treble is for Carebears; I want bass on every track!
Fanboy #1: But bass ruins the entire album!
This scenario of course would never happen, because no one cares about a man with no prior history, offering no specific details, who is claiming that some time in the future he may or may not release an album. A horde of fans would not magically appear, descend upon his website, and begin discussing something which he has yet to record.
But now replace these words in the Fanboy conversation: Bass with PvP, Treble with PvE, and Album with Game. Viola, you pretty much have any pre-release MMO forum, anywhere on the Internet. Thousands of people arguing about a game about which they know either nothing, or next to nothing about, suggesting changes be made to systems that likely haven't even been programmed yet and may not even make it to the final version.
It would seem that much like members of the Party in George Orwell's 1984, the community as a collective whole is incapable of making logical distinctions between fiction and reality when it comes to the realm of MMOs. If the Party says that Oceania is at war with Eastasia, then Oceania has always been at war with Eastasia. If a developer says a feature will be in release, who are we to doubt?
But rather than being systematically brainwashed by a corrupt political system run amok, we are like the poster on Fox Mulder's wall, "I want to believe." It doesn't matter that the last ten developer's promises never came to fruition, were severely scaled back, or the game was outright canceled. This game will be different. There's no way this team could possibly s***w this up. The game will be without flaw, truly the greatest MMO of all time.
A year of hype later, the game is released a flop. Six months late with missing or incomplete features, unstable code, and without a shred of content.
We grudgingly play it a few weeks because nothing else is out, and then go back to our old reliable, the first or second generation game we continue to have an on again off again love affair with, to see what content they've patched since we last logged in.
Then, a few months down the road, another new MMO is announced and the cycle starts all over again from the beginning. Can we possibly be this stupid? Sadly, yes we can.
